10th August is observed as World Bio-Fuel Day in a bid to create awareness about non fossil fuels.
Significance of Day:
On this day in 1893, Sir Rudalph Diesel for the 1st time successfully ran mechanical engine with Peanut Oil.His research experiment had predicted that vegetable oil is going to replace the fossil fuels in the next century to fuel different mechanical engines.
The World Biofuel Day is observed every year on 10th August. Observations in India On this occasion 4 retail outlets of bio fuel blended diesel were launched by the Union Petroleum Minister Dharmendra Pradhan.
About Bio-fuels:
- They are renewable, bio degradable, sustainable and environment friendly fuel. It can be seen as alternative to conventional fossil-fuels.
- Bio fuels trend in India Presently ethanol blended petrol programme is being promoted India. In this case ethanol is blended in petrol with permissible limit ranging from 5 to 10% depending on the availability of ethanol.
- Bio Diesel is used in various modes to transportation in India such as Railways, shipping and State Road Transport Corporations.
